Hydrolic

Noun

Definition: A type of machine or system that uses fluid pressure to transmit power.

Example Sentence: The hydrolic system in the car allows for smooth and efficient braking.

Adjective

Definition: Pertaining to or operated by a fluid, especially under pressure.

Example Sentence: The hydrolic pump needs to be inspected regularly to ensure proper functioning.
